Output 51fb2d64dd1e28d8eec4c089bd1a95f25c975d05e33fd7abc545179b111e0505:0

value
1957908904
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 949fa5012abd73dc24acd5e620cb8656a0220912 OP_EQUALVERIFY OP_CHECKSIG
address
1EYrFgwZHWkKvjzjQMpFNNhcHAkopF8Bth
transaction
51fb2d64dd1e28d8eec4c089bd1a95f25c975d05e33fd7abc545179b111e0505
spent
true